1. AVAILABLE CABINS/ROOMS

The Lodge has 4 cabins, AND 6 upstairs, guest rooms

 

The Cabins all have an ensuite with shower, toilet and vanity unit and a balcony offering glorious views. However there are NO cooking facilities in our rooms, because of the limited electricity and water facilities. We supply most weekend meals, however, self catering is available with the OK of our chef. Please see catering arrangements below.

 

The upstairs guest rooms, all have stunning views, and share 2 shower rooms, and 2 toilets, each with mirrors and basins.

 

The main building has a community kitchen, large area dining area with fire, large lounge with open fire, and large adjoining balcony’s, facing north and south. The cabin and house balconies are the areas where  guest’s spend most time, chilling out, chatting, & soaking up the Island’s isolation, bird-life and scenery.
